   An update that has one recommended fix can now be installed.

Description:

   This update for python-rsa fixes the following issues:

   - The error "update-alternatives: error: alternative pyrsa-decrypt-bigfile
     can't be master" does no longer occur when updating to a newer package
     version (bsc#1154763)
